Autodesk's Licensing Platform Group is seeking a passionate software engineer to join a team of diverse, smart, and driven engineers who are responsible for building the cloud licensing platform. This system is at the forefront of the company's licensing and has tremendous visibility and impact across all of Autodesk. This engineer will collaborate within a high performing Scrum team where the code and services you develop will have a direct, positive impact to millions of users of our products. This experience is key to our business and one of our top initiatives around transformation and customer experience. Responsibilities Work closely with architects and technical product managers to translate overall system architecture and product requirements into well-designed and implemented software components
Take ownership of the implementation of individual software components, with high emphasis on quality, test-driven development, and sound software engineering practices
Participate in software design reviews, you conduct peer code reviews, and provide input and feedback to other members of the development team
Collaborate as a member of an agile team to get products and components developed and completed with best in class software development
Minimum Qualifications Experience in delivering highly available, scalable, distributed systems and microservices in a production setting
Experience with Spring
Experience with Java
Basic knowledge of server programming, databases, and cloud architectures
Experience with container frameworks (Docker)
Experience with microservices and RESTful web services
Experience working in Agile/Scrum environment is desired
Excellent technical problem solving skills and aptitude to learn new technologies and methodologies

Learn more about our benefits in the U.S. by visiting https://benefits.autodesk.com/ Salary transparency Salary is one part of Autodesk’s competitive compensation package. For U.S.-based roles, we expect a starting base salary between $109,400 and $188,760. Offers are based on the candidate’s experience and geographic location, and may exceed this range. In addition to base salaries, we also have a significant emphasis on annual cash bonuses, commissions for sales roles, stock grants, and a comprehensive benefits package.
